As people seem to be fond of saying nowadays, "stop right here".  What
you've installed is not the official Cygwin distribution, and certainly
not using the official Cygwin installer, so it's not supported on this
list.  Thus, any problems that you have with the resulting installation
should be first addressed to whoever provided the package you've installed
(i.e., copssh).  FWICS, they have a forum -- try asking there.

If you'd like to receive support on this list (and get a system that
works, to boot), try uninstalling copssh and installing Cygwin using the
official installer (the "Install or update Cygwin now" link on the main
Cygwin website) -- simply select the openssh package, and read
/usr/share/doc/Cygwin/openssh.README.

Otherwise, thank you for following all the directions on the "Problem
Reports" page, but we can't really help you.
